Maximizing Your Home Value : Understanding Home Value Trends
To foster your net worth, it's essential to comprehend the current trends in home value. The real estate market is constantly evolving, and staying abreast of these shifts can significantly affect your home's value over time. By analyzing recent sales data, evaluating market factors, and speaking to a qualified real estate professional, you can acquire valuable knowledge into the factors that affect home values in your area.
- Explore recent sales data for comparable properties in your community.
- Monitor local market signals, such as interest rates, inventory levels, and buyer demand.
- Discuss with a reputable real estate agent who has familiarity with your area's market.
This knowledge can enable you to make wise decisions about investing in real estate, ultimately boosting your equity and achieving your investment goals.
Assessing Property Value Assessment: What Affects Your Home's Worth?
A variety of factors influence to the overall value of a property. One of the most significant variables is location. Homes situated in desirable neighborhoods with excellent schools, low crime rates, and convenient access to amenities often command greater prices.
, Additionally, the size and layout of a home have a substantial role in its worth. Features like numerous bedrooms, bathrooms, and living spaces are commonly preferred by buyers.
The condition of the property is property selling services another essential factor. Upkept homes with modern upgrades tend to fetch higher prices than those that require significant repairs or renovations.
- Lastly, the current market conditions can also influence property values. A strong real estate market may result in higher home prices, while a slow market may lead to decreases in value.
